Alan R. Christensen is the President and Head of Investment Risk at Fayez Sarofim & Co. Mr. Christensen joined the firm in 2005. He is a member of Fayez Sarofim & Co.’s Executive and Investment Committees and is also on the Board of Sarofim Trust Company. Mr. Christensen is a co-manager of the mutual funds that Fayez Sarofim & Co. manages for BNY Mellon. He is also a portfolio manager for a variety of institutional and high net worth clients. Over the years, areas of research and responsibility have included companies in the technology and industrials sectors.
Mr. Christensen received an M.B.A. with Distinction from Cornell University in 2005, where he was a Park Fellow and a B.A. in Economics and History from Washington & Lee University in 1995, where he graduated cum laude. Prior to joining Fayez Sarofim & Co., he was employed with Alvarez & Marsal as a Director and Accenture as a Senior Manager in Capital Markets.
Mr. Christensen currently serves as a Director of Sarofim Irish Collective Asset Management Vehicle (ICAV). He is a graduate of the Center for Houston’s Future Leadership Forum, and is a member of YPO (Young President’s Organization). He previously served on the boards of Annunciation Orthodox School, Palmer Memorial Endowment Fund and the Tompkins County Community Foundation.
